To understand this internal power, we must look beyond fictional blockbusters and ancient mythologies. Joseph Campbell, the famous mythologist who mapped the "Hero's Journey," argued that the archetypal hero is ultimately a symbol for the human psyche. The journey outward into a world of monsters and challenges is actually a metaphor for the journey inward.
